滇东南喀斯特山区石漠化程度与坡位因子的关联机制研究

石漠化作为一种土地退化现象,是中国西南喀斯特地区的主要生态问题之一.探寻石漠化分布规律及影响机制是石漠化有效治理的关键.文章以滇东南喀斯特山区的3个典型实验区为研究对象,提取石漠化程度及坡位信息,探讨不同等级石漠化沿坡位的分布规律,并采用通径分析法研究石漠化程度与坡位的关联机制.结果表明:(1)实验区内从山脊到山谷石漠化面积逐渐减少,而非石漠化面积逐渐上升,石漠化主要分布在坡位高的地方;其中轻度石漠化多发生在山脊和上坡,中度石漠化多发生在山脊、上坡和下坡,重度石漠化在各坡位的分布较均匀.(2)坡位与石漠化程度的相关性显著,坡位直接影响着石漠化的分布规律.同时,坡位对石漠化的影响受到坡度与地形切割深度间接的强化作用.(3)坡位与石漠化程度的关联机制是:当区域以自然演化状态为主时,坡位与石漠化程度呈负关联,坡位越高,伴随坡度与地形切割深度变大,导致高坡位区域物质迁移更加频繁,石漠化的程度加剧;当区域人类活动影响明显时,坡位与石漠化程度呈正关联,坡位越低,随同坡度与地形切割深度较小,人类活动更加方便且频繁,消耗了由高坡位到低坡位的堆积物质,使石漠化程度加深.研究结果能为喀斯特山区石漠化程度综合影响机制的深入分析提供参考,为山区石漠化治理及生态恢复措施制定提供依据.
Correlation mechanism between rocky desertification degrees and slope position factors in karst mountainous area of southeast Yunnan
As a kind of land degradation phenomenon,rocky desertification is one of the main ecological problems in karst areas in Southwest China.The key to the effective control of rocky desertification is to explore the distribution law and influence mechanism of rocky desertification.Taking three typical experimental areas in the karst mountainous area of southeast Yunnan as the research subjects,we extracted rocky desertification degrees and slope position factors as variables,and analyzed the correlation mechanism between these two variables.We also explored the roles of terrain factors such as slope gradients,slope aspects,terrain cutting depths,etc.in the correlation mechanism in order to further clarify the distribution law of different degrees of rocky desertification at different slope positions under the natural conditions as well as under the human interference.This study provides support for the case study on distribution and influence mechanism of rocky desertification in karst mountainous areas,and provides scientific basis for monitoring and restoring the regional ecological environment.The results show as follows:(1)The area of rocky desertification decreased gradually from ridge to valley,mainly distributed in the areas in high slope positions.Accordingly,the area of non-rocky desertification increased gradually.Slight rocky desertification mostly occurs along the ridge and on the uphill slope,while moderate rocky desertification mostly occurs at the ridge,and on the uphill and downhill slopes.The heavy rocky desertification is distributed in a uniform way in each slope position.(2)Slope positions are significantly correlated with degrees of rocky desertification,and directly affect the distribution law of rocky desertification.At the same time,the effect of slope positions on rocky desertification is indirectly enhanced by slope gradients and terrain cutting depths.(3)The correlation mechanism between slope positions and degrees of rocky desertification is demonstrated below.If the area is dominated by natural evolution,slope positions are negatively correlated with degrees of rocky desertification.The higher the slope position is,the greater the slope gradient and the deeper the terrain cutting will be.In this case,the increasing frequency of material migration in the area of high slope position will intensify the degree of rocky desertification.Conversely,the lower the slope position is,the smaller the slope gradient and the terrain cutting will be.In this case,human activities will become more convenient and frequent,which may consume the accumulated materials from the high slope position to the low and intensify the rocky desertification.The implications of research findings indicate that the geomorphic structure of the karst area is relatively complex according to the field investigation,and relevant research should be carried out based on the geographical environment of the study area.Most studies on rocky desertification have been conducted at a large or medium scale such as at a scale of the river basin or of the administrative unit,and the driving factors of different research scales have different influences on the degrees of rocky desertification.In addition,degrees of rocky desertification in different slope positions are significantly different.In the natural distribution,materials are lost along the ridge and accumulate in the valley.In rocky desertification areas,soil and other materials are lost along the ridge,and some remain in the valley.Furthermore,rocky desertification degrees are significantly correlated with slope positions,and the internal correlation mechanisms between rocky desertification degrees and slope positions are different under different intensities of human activity.Human interference is also an important factor affecting the correlation between slope positions and rocky desertification degrees.The research results can provide reference for in-depth analysis of the comprehensive influencing mechanism of rocky desertification degrees in karst mountainous areas,and provide basis for rocky desertification control and ecological restoration in mountainous areas.
